Firewalk

Upper 6 and Gold DofE students , Parents and Staff will be walking bare foot on Hot embers for the schools Charities. The participants will transform their fears, to success and take on the 10 meter glowing runway. Please show them support.

Story

Our firewalk will be raising vital funds for the schools charities.

These are comprised of the schools own charity:

Bramston Bursary Foundation - www.stswithuns.com/about-us/bramston-bursary-foundation

The foundation supports girls from extremely disadvantaged backgrounds with fully funded boarding places at St Swithuns, via a transformational bursary.

Alongside the Bramston Bursary Foundation, there are three charities chosen by our students:

Planned Parenthood - www.plannedparenthood.org

An American charity (not for profit) that supports women and men with birth control options, sexual health care, abortion advice, cancer screenings.

Humanitarian Aid Relief Trust (HART) - www.hart-uk.org

HART is committed to serving people in need, especially those who are or who have been suffering from oppression and persecution.

Kids for Kids - www.kidsforkids.org.uk

Tackling malnutrition sustainably with goat's milk
